About

Step into a winter wonderland at the Festival of Trees, where the Sidney & Berne Davis Art Center is transformed into a dazzling spectacle of holiday cheer. Local businesses and artists showcase their creativity by decorating stunning trees, each a unique masterpiece. Attendees can wander through the enchanting display, purchase raffle tickets for a chance to win their favorite tree, and participate in a variety of special events.

Event Details

Pricing

$2 per person admission, $10 for raffle tickets (or bundles). Free entry with new toy donation. Under age 5 enter for free.

Duration

Varies by day, with special events throughout

Ages

All ages welcome, free entry for under 5

Schedule

Viewing Times: Thursday, December 4th | 11am โ€“ 9pm, Friday, December 5th | 11am โ€“ 10pm, Saturday, December 6th | 10am โ€“ 10pm, Sunday, December 7th | 11am โ€“ 6pm. Special Events: Preview Party Wednesday, December 3rd 6:00pm โ€“ 8:00pm, Wine and Paint Thursday, December 4th 6:00pm โ€“ 9:00pm, Giant Wreath Lighting and Live Music Friday, December 5th 6:00pm โ€“ 10:00pm, Santas Block Party Saturday, December 6th 10:00am โ€“ 2:00pm, Raffle Drawing Sunday, December 7th (winners drawn at 5pm).

Organizer

Goodwill of Southwest Florida and SBDAC

Frequently Asked Questions

What is the Festival of Trees?

The Festival of Trees is an annual event where local businesses and artists decorate trees that are displayed and available to win through a raffle, with proceeds benefiting local charities.

How much does it cost to attend?

General admission is $2 per person. Entry is free with a new toy donation, and children under 5 are also admitted for free.

Can I win one of the decorated trees?

Yes, you can purchase raffle tickets for a chance to win your favorite decorated tree. Various ticket bundles are available.

What special events are happening during the festival?

Special events include a Preview Party, Wine and Paint, a Giant Wreath Lighting with live music, and Santa's Block Party.

Who benefits from this event?

Proceeds from the Festival of Trees benefit Goodwill of Southwest Florida and the Sidney & Berne Davis Art Center, as well as local children's charities through the toy drive.
